Output 84c01f2dc99b175e0da8fa6cbdef342b800365c491212e23d8daecda629ade60:0

value
23177397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eccd8b58e3cf533c0787d6a08f540a9985d3791 OP_EQUAL
address
MDdDXJuAY6KST4yC69bwFjw6EyqnjbNdZo
transaction
84c01f2dc99b175e0da8fa6cbdef342b800365c491212e23d8daecda629ade60
spent
true